Bear Valley, CA...Winter returns tomorrow with cold temps and snow down to the 2,000ft level. Hopefully the systems will bring a bit more moisture than is forecast. A winter storm warning has been issued for Tuesday and Wednesday and is enclosed below the 7-Day forecast. Washington's Birthday Mostly sunny, with a high near 45. Light and variable wind becoming south southwest 11 to 16 mph in the morning. Winds could gust as high as 24 mph. Tonight Snow, mainly after 4am. Low around 21. South wind 8 to 13 mph, with gusts as high as 20 mph. Chance of precipitation is 80%. New snow accumulation of less than one inch possible. Tuesday Snow showers. High near 28. South southwest wind around 17 mph, with gusts as high as 29 mph. Chance of precipitation is 100%. New snow accumulation of 4 to 8 inches possible. Tuesday Night Snow showers, mainly before 10pm. Low around 12. Southwest wind 5 to 9 mph becoming calm in the evening. Chance of precipitation is 90%. New snow accumulation of 1 to 2 inches possible....
Bear Valley, CA...Dave Wagner and friends were out snowmobiling in the high country when they came around the corner and saw this sled being reduced to a pile of molten pile of plastic and metal. The rider has some superficial burns but was otherwise alright. So...lets be careful out there even if you are only sledding...
